"""Perform the initial setup of the application, by creating the auth
and settings database."""

import argparse
import os
import sys
import builtins

# Grab the SERVER_MODE if it's been set by the runtime
if 'SERVER_MODE' in globals():
    builtins.SERVER_MODE = globals()['SERVER_MODE']
else:
    builtins.SERVER_MODE = None

# We need to include the root directory in sys.path to ensure that we can
# find everything we need when running in the standalone runtime.
root = os.path.dirname(os.path.realpath(__file__))
if sys.path[0] != root:
    sys.path.insert(0, root)

from pgadmin.model import db, Version, SCHEMA_VERSION as CURRENT_SCHEMA_VERSION
from pgadmin import create_app
from pgadmin.utils import clear_database_servers, dump_database_servers,\
    load_database_servers


def dump_servers(args):
    """Dump the server groups and servers.

    Args:
        args (ArgParser): The parsed command line options
    """

    # What user?
    if args.user is not None:
        dump_user = args.user
    else:
        dump_user = config.DESKTOP_USER

    # And the sqlite path
    if args.sqlite_path is not None:
        config.SQLITE_PATH = args.sqlite_path

    print('----------')
    print('Dumping servers with:')
    print('User:', dump_user)
    print('SQLite pgAdmin config:', config.SQLITE_PATH)
    print('----------')

    app = create_app(config.APP_NAME + '-cli')
    with app.app_context():
        dump_database_servers(args.dump_servers, args.servers, dump_user, True)


def load_servers(args):
    """Load server groups and servers.

    Args:
        args (ArgParser): The parsed command line options
    """

    # What user?
    load_user = args.user if args.user is not None else config.DESKTOP_USER

    # And the sqlite path
    if args.sqlite_path is not None:
        config.SQLITE_PATH = args.sqlite_path

    print('----------')
    print('Loading servers with:')
    print('User:', load_user)
    print('SQLite pgAdmin config:', config.SQLITE_PATH)
    print('----------')

    app = create_app(config.APP_NAME + '-cli')
    with app.app_context():
        load_database_servers(args.load_servers, None, load_user, True)


def setup_db():
    """Setup the configuration database."""

    create_app_data_directory(config)

    app = create_app()

    print("pgAdmin 4 - Application Initialisation")
    print("======================================\n")

    with app.app_context():
        # Run migration for the first time i.e. create database
        from config import SQLITE_PATH
        if not os.path.exists(SQLITE_PATH):
            db_upgrade(app)
        else:
            version = Version.query.filter_by(name='ConfigDB').first()
            schema_version = version.value

            # Run migration if current schema version is greater than the
            # schema version stored in version table
            if CURRENT_SCHEMA_VERSION >= schema_version:
                db_upgrade(app)

            # Update schema version to the latest
            if CURRENT_SCHEMA_VERSION > schema_version:
                version = Version.query.filter_by(name='ConfigDB').first()
                version.value = CURRENT_SCHEMA_VERSION
                db.session.commit()

        if os.name != 'nt':
            os.chmod(config.SQLITE_PATH, 0o600)


def clear_servers():
    """Clear groups and servers configurations.

    Args:
        args (ArgParser): The parsed command line options
    """

    # What user?
    load_user = args.user if args.user is not None else config.DESKTOP_USER

    # And the sqlite path
    if args.sqlite_path is not None:
        config.SQLITE_PATH = args.sqlite_path

    app = create_app(config.APP_NAME + '-cli')
    with app.app_context():
        clear_database_servers(load_user, True)
